Does anybody know where i can get SFXCAB.EXE?

as far as i understand this is the program used to package new hotfixes (type 1)/service packs. IExpress is the older program to create cab sfx archives and it's icluded with XP. but there's no mention of sfxcab.exe anywhere? i can open SP2 with power archiver, but it doesn't let me add files because it says that it is a solid archive. even if i got it to work i would (probably) lose the digital signature of the file.

what i'm trying to do is repackage SP2 with custom netfw.inf files so that i get firewall settings with the install through SUS.

ideas anyone? i'm all out.

wait why r u doing it this way?

1. attended: u can extract the files from sp2 exe, modify netfw.inf and just run update.exe from network, sus or cd...

2. unattended: slipstream sp2 to the cd, put the modified netfw.inf file to the cd too, then run setup.

unfortunately, ykolomiyets, SFXCAB.EXE is not available anywhere and only Microsoft can make SFXCAB packages.

Quote from Gurgelmeyer-

[quote name='Gurgelmeyer' post='310133' date='Apr 24 2005, 04:11 AM']SFXCAB's are created only by Microsoft, and there are no tools, no documentation or anything else available to help others create SFXCAB's. :no:

The /integrate option btw is passed to UPDATE.EXE, which then examines the UPDATE.INF and does the slipstream - SFXCAB.EXE doesn't do much itself really. /integrate will FAIL if UPDATE.INF is not "signed" - that is, if it does not contain a reference to a Microsoft signed .CAT file with a checksum of the .INF itself. You'll need to "help" UPDATE.EXE overcome this and similar other "shortcomings" just to make it do anything at all btw. :yes:[/quote]
